Serves meat, vegan options available. Restaurant group offering New American cuisine with a healthier focus. The menu changes seasonally and will include labeled vegan dishes & options such as vegetable-based starters, savory bowl with tofu option, cheese-less pizza, and a couple of salads. Has fresh juices. Open Mon-Thu 11:00am-10:00pm, Fri 11:00am-11:00pm, Sat 10:00am-11:00pm, Sun 10:00am-9:00pm.

A Great Place to Eat - but sit outside

On our first visit to True Food Kitchen, my husband and I were blown away when the hostess greeted us promptly with menus (of course) and also (here’s the surprise) a laminated copy of Dr. Andrew Weil’s Anti-Inflammatory Food Pyramid. And although we haven't been given the educational handout on recent visits, the pyramid is prominently displayed as artwork on one of the walls. I'm not sure that the pyramid gets as much attention on the wall, so I wish the restaurant would still provide the handout. After all, the connection to Dr. Weil's food-as-medicine philosophy is what really sets the restaurant apart.

Our server was quick to inform us that the restaurant takes great pride in offering scratch-made dishes that are prepared with locally-obtained, seasonal ingredients. The menu contained plenty of choices for vegetarians, with roughly half of the items being meat free. No guessing needed; items were clearly marked as being vegetarian, vegan and/or gluten free.

Many dishes on the menu featured interesting items which are gaining attention as healthy alternatives to less nutritious foods. Some of the more unusual ingredients that we noted were fennel, daikon radish, sea buckthorn, chia seed, anasazi bean, flax seed, spaghetti squash, mulberries, kale, and farro.

My favorite dish is the TLT sandwich. I love the tempeh "bacon" and appreciate the fact that the bread is whole grain. The side dish of sweet potato hash provides some nice color to the plate.

I'm happy to report that our server provided good service and, when asked, could describe how the food was prepared. Many other positive aspects that we noted included the open kitchen, recycled content furniture, live plants on the tables, and outstanding patron education.

We normally prefer to visit True Food when the weather is relatively warm and we can sit outside, because the indoor seating tends to be unusually noisy when the restaurant is full (as it always seems to be). Be sure to make a reservation, and then ask for an outdoor table when you arrive.
